Traditional Photography: A Timeless Classic
For years, traditional photography has been the standard method for showcasing products. By capturing real-world images of products, photographers can create stunning visuals that accurately represent the product's appearance and texture. However, traditional photography has its limitations:
Limited Flexibility: Once a product is photographed, it's difficult to change the image. You can't easily alter the background, lighting, or the product's position. This limits the creative possibilities for presenting the product.
Time-Consuming: Traditional photography can take a lot of time, especially for products with many different parts or variations. Setting up the product, adjusting the lighting, and capturing the perfect shot can be a lengthy process.
Costly: Traditional photography can be expensive, especially for high-quality product images. Costs can include studio rentals, hiring professional photographers, and paying for post-production editing.
3D Modeling: The Future of Product Visualization
3D Modeling Services offer a more flexible and cost-effective approach to product visualization. By creating digital 3D models of products, designers can easily manipulate and modify the product's appearance, lighting, and background. This gives designers more freedom to experiment with different looks and create the perfect image.
Key Benefits of 3D Modeling:
Unlimited Possibilities: 3D models can be viewed from any angle, showing every detail of a product. You can zoom in on specific features, rotate the product, or change the lighting to highlight different aspects. This gives you complete control over how the product is presented.
Faster Time-to-Market: 3D models can be created and rendered quickly, which means new products can be launched faster. You don't have to wait for real products to be made before showing them off.
Cost-Effective: 3D modeling can save you money. You don't need to create physical product samples or rent expensive studio space. This leads it to a more cost-effective alternative for many firms.
Augmented Reality and Virtual Reality Applications: 3D Augmented Reality Models can be used to create amazing AR and VR experiences. Customers can interact with products in new and exciting ways, such as trying on virtual clothes or taking a virtual tour of a house. This can help to increase sales and brand engagement.
Choosing the Right Approach
The best approach to 3D Product Visualization depends on various factors, including the nature of the product, the target audience, and the budget. In many cases, a combination of 3D modeling and traditional photography can provide the best results.
For example, 3D models can be used to create realistic product visualizations, while traditional photography can be used to capture high-quality images of the actual product. By combining these two techniques, businesses can create compelling and effective product visuals that drive sales and brand awareness.
